A gulet is a traditional wooden sailing vessel that has been modernized to offer all the comforts of a luxury cruise. These boats typically have spacious decks for lounging, cozy cabins, and a crew to cater to your every need. The intimate size of gulets allows for a personalized experience that larger cruise ships can’t match.
The Bay of Kotor, often referred to as Europe’s southernmost fjord,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its steep mountains that plunge into the sea, charming coastal villages, and medieval architecture. Sailing through the bay on a gulet cruise offers unparalleled views of the rugged coastline and the charming towns that dot the shore.
One of the highlights of a gulet cruise kotor is the chance to visit the ancient walled city of Kotor itself. This medieval town is a maze of narrow streets, squares, and churches that are sure to transport you back in time. Climb the city walls to get a bird’s eye view of the red-tiled roofs and the shimmering waters of the bay below. Don’t forget to explore St. Tryphon Cathedral and the Maritime Museum to learn more about Kotor’s rich history.
Another must-see destination in the Bay of Kotor is the picturesque village of Perast. This tiny town is nestled at the foot of a steep hill and is known for its baroque architecture and two stunning islands just off the coast. Our Lady of the Rocks and St. George Island are both accessible by boat and offer a glimpse into Montenegro’s religious and cultural heritage.

Of course, no gulet cruise in Montenegro would be complete without sampling the delicious local cuisine. Montenegro is known for its fresh seafood, hearty stews, and homemade cheeses. Be sure to try the local specialty, black risotto, made with squid ink, or sample some locally caught fish grilled to perfection.
